Heads of Azerbaijan`s religious confessions call over latest Armenian provocation
The appeal reads that religious leaders have always sought peace and understanding in the world.
“Recent armed provocations by the Armenians on the contact line of Azerbaijani and Armenian troops proved Armenia’s invasion policy once again. Seeking to find a peaceful solution to the conflict and prevent further rise in the number of innocent victims, the Azerbaijani side first declared a unilateral ceasefire. Although an agreement on mutual ceasefire has now been reached, the opposite side continues violating the ceasefire,” say the leaders.
The appeal go on to outline that the whole world, including Armenians themselves, do know that Nagorno-Karabakh is Azerbaijani land.
“Azerbaijan’s territorial integrity is recognized in all international documents. The illegal regime, called the Nagorno-Karabakh Republic, has not been accepted by any international organization or state. Nevertheless, the territories under occupation are a fertile ground for any illegal acts. We bow our heads in respect for the souls of our compatriots who were martyred fighting for the territorial integrity of the motherland, and extend our condolences to their families and close ones as well as the entire people of Azerbaijan. We ask Allah to have mercy on them, and wish the wounded recover soon,” the appeal concludes.
